The Chevy Duramax engine is manufactured by a collaboration between General Motors and Isuzu Motors. This partnership began in the early 2000s and has produced a series of powerful diesel engines known for their performance and durability.
Chevy Duramax Engine Evolution and Features
The Duramax engine line debuted in 2001, designed primarily for heavy-duty trucks. It has evolved through various generations, each improving upon the last in terms of power, efficiency, and emissions control. This engine is widely recognized for its robust performance, making it a popular choice among truck enthusiasts and commercial users alike.
The collaboration between General Motors and Isuzu ensures that the Duramax engines integrate advanced technology and engineering excellence. This partnership leverages Isuzu’s expertise in diesel engine design, resulting in a product that meets diverse consumer needs.

Understanding the specifications of the Duramax engine helps consumers make informed decisions. Below is a table detailing the key specifications of various Duramax engine models.
| Engine Model | Displacement | Horsepower | Torque | Fuel Type |
|---|---|---|---|---|
| L5P | 6.6L | 445 hp | 910 lb-ft | Diesel |
| LML | 6.6L | 397 hp | 765 lb-ft | Diesel |
| LBZ | 6.6L | 360 hp | 650 lb-ft | Diesel |
| LLY | 6.6L | 360 hp | 650 lb-ft | Diesel |
These specifications highlight the range of power and torque available in different Duramax models. The L5P, for instance, is particularly noted for its high torque output, making it suitable for towing and heavy-duty applications.

While the Duramax engine is known for its durability, some common issues can arise over time. Being aware of these problems can help owners address them proactively. Common issues include:
-
Injector failure due to fuel quality
-
Turbocharger wear from excessive heat
-
EGR system clogging impacting emissions
-
Oil leaks from aging seals and gaskets
Addressing these issues promptly can prevent costly repairs and ensure the engine remains in good working condition.
